Job Summary:
The Continuous Improvement Intern will play a crucial role in supporting our continuous improvement initiatives as part of our Distribution Centre (DC) operations. The intern will actively seek continuous improvement opportunities and define optimal solutions, working closely with the distribution center teams, subcontractors, and other company members. Focusing on increasing value, eliminating waste, reducing costs, and improving service within the DC.
Optimize Operational Processes:
- Analyze current operational processes to identify inefficiencies and areas for improvement.
- Develop continuous improvement roadmaps and report milestones and successes.
- Work with cross-functional teams to redesign processes, reduce waste, and increase productivity.
- Implement best practices and standardized procedures to streamline operations.
- Support communication and change management operations related to distribution optimization and transformation projects.
Support Process Optimization with World-Class Visual Management:
- Design and implement visual management tools and techniques to support process optimization and enhance transparency.
- Support with the creation of dashboards, visual boards, and other visual aids to communicate key performance indicators (KPls) and progress towards goals.
- Contribute to the development of new process training materials and participate in training staff at the DC
Qualifications:
- Currently pursuing a bachelor's or master's degree in Engineering, Business Management (operations, logistics, supply chain), or a related field.
- Strong communication and interpersonal skills.
- Strong analytical and problem-solving skills.
- Knowledge of process improvement methodologies (e.g Lean Six Sigma) is a strong asset
- Proficiency in Microsoft Office Suite (Excel, PowerPoint, Word)
